#b1dcdb basic color information

#b1dcdb

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#b1dcdb has decimal index of: 11656411, is composed of 69.4% red, 86.3% green and 85.9% blue. #b1dcdb in CMYK color model, is composed of 19.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 0.5% yellow and 13.7% black.
#99cccc is the closest web-safe color to #b1dcdb.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
